Step-by-Step Assembly Guide

Begin by placing the base unit on a flat, stable surface. Align the locking bar to secure the juicer top onto the base. Attach the spout and pulp container to the main unit, ensuring they click firmly into place. Next, insert the motorized pusher into the feeder chute, making sure it fits snugly. Connect the juice pitcher and pulp container to their respective outlets. Finally, plug in the power cord and ensure all parts are securely locked. Refer to the manual for exact alignment and orientation of components. Once assembled, double-check that all parts are tightly fitted and ready for operation. Proper assembly ensures safe and effective juicing.

Choosing the Right Produce

Selecting the right fruits and vegetables ensures optimal juice extraction and flavor. Popular choices include apples, carrots, oranges, and leafy greens like spinach or kale. Wash all produce thoroughly before juicing to remove dirt and pesticides. Peel citrus fruits and remove pits or seeds from fruits like peaches or cherries, as these can damage the juicer; Hard vegetables like beets or ginger can be juiced whole, while softer options like cucumbers or celery are best cut into smaller pieces. Avoid using unripe or overly fibrous produce, as they may not yield well. For leafy greens, fold them into tight bunches to enhance extraction efficiency. Experiment with combinations to find your preferred taste and nutritional balance.

Disassembling the Juicer

To disassemble the Jack Lalanne Power Juicer, start by unplugging it from the power source for safety. Next, unlock the locking bar located on the front of the machine and lift it to release the juicer cover. Carefully remove the cover and set it aside. The pulp container can then be detached by sliding it out from under the juicer base. Remove the strainer basket from the juicer cover and rinse it under warm water to loosen any pulp. Finally, separate the pusher and other accessories for individual cleaning. Disassembling the juicer regularly ensures thorough cleaning and maintains its performance. Always handle the components with care to avoid damage.

Solutions for Improved Performance

To enhance the Jack Lalanne Power Juicer’s performance, clean the strainer regularly with a brush to remove pulp buildup. Ensure all components are properly assembled and aligned. Chop produce into small pieces, avoiding hard or fibrous materials unless shredded. Avoid overloading the chute, as this can slow down the motor. Freezing fruits and vegetables slightly can reduce foaming and improve yield. Lubricate moving parts periodically to maintain smooth operation. For optimal results, follow the manual’s guidelines for preparation and usage. Regular maintenance ensures the juicer operates efficiently, delivering high-quality juice consistently.
